Transaction 2f8091319c5bbb158d947120ae0dc955bc93ceb8e1db0f0a4776df51586e3114

1 Input
2 Outputs
  • 2f8091319c5bbb158d947120ae0dc955bc93ceb8e1db0f0a4776df51586e3114:0
  • value  622276725
    address  15HUyGgQvQL92aBKcRftQ5sDFxFZCryYbA
  • 2f8091319c5bbb158d947120ae0dc955bc93ceb8e1db0f0a4776df51586e3114:1
  • value  1683000
    address  1BtpqFwtjkFBsuMSJgeC6AimMD2kH2To7f